Suva Magistrate Jeremaia Savou has adjourned the plea date of Ronal Vikash Nair who was charged for allegedly causing the death of a 28-year-old woman at Stinson Parade in Suva on March 27, last year.

Nair was charged with one count of dangerous driving causing death.

On October 26, 2023, the Nasese bus, driven by Nair, allegedly hit the woman at Stinson Parade in Suva, while she was attempting to cross the zebra crossing.
